Transplant Leukemia Clinical Coordinator (RN)

Northside Hospital Inc.·Sandy Springs, Georgia

Full Time·On Site·2-5 yrs·Posted 2 months ago
Practice for this role

About the role

The Clinical Coordinator is responsible for coordinating all clinical activities related to the Bone Marrow Transplant, Immunotherapy, Hematologic Malignancy, or Leukemia Programs. This role involves working with adolescent, adult, and geriatric patients.

Overview Northside Hospital is award-winning, state-of-the-art, and continually growing. Constantly expanding the quality and reach of our care to our patients and communities creates even more opportunity for the best healthcare professionals in Atlanta and beyond. Discover all the possibilities of a career at Northside today.

Responsibilities

The Cellular Therapy/Leukemia/Blood Cancer/ Graft vs Host Disease (GVHD) Clinical Coordinator is a professional with working knowledge of hematologic malignancies, leukemia treatment, bone marrow/peripheral blood stem cell transplantation and related protocols and research. This professional is responsible for the coordination of all clinical activities relating to the Bone Marrow Transplant, Immunotherapy, Hematologic Malignancy or Leukemia Programs. Works with adolescent, adult and geriatric patients.

Qualifications

REQUIRED A Bachelor’s Degree from an accredited school of nursing. Current License in the State of Georgia as a Registered Nurse or Nursing Compact (NLC/eNLC) or Multistate License. Two (2) years of experience as a Registered Nurse. Must hold American Heart Association Basic Life Support. PREFERRED Three or more years with previous leukemia and/or transplant experience. Certified in oncology or transplant. Demonstrated skills in use personal computer, including Excel and PowerPoint software. Previous experience in oncology, hematology and/or bone marrow transplant. Strong interpersonal and organizational skills and ability to be highly motivated and work independently. Excellent oral and written communications skills. Work Hours: 8:30am-5:00pm Weekend Requirements: No On-Call Requirements: No
